Monroe drops twinbill to Genesee
By Paul Gotham ROCHESTER, N.Y. -- Battered and bruised the Monroe Community College nine are happy to leave behind the first weekend of the fall season. After splitting a doubleheader on Friday, the MCC Tribunes fell to the Genesee Community College Cougars 12-5 and 10-0 in WNYAC play at Buckland Park, Monday afternoon. Alloco and Harris set their sights on UD
By Paul Casey Gotham From one regional contender to another, that is what lies ahead for a pair of Tribune diamond men. Ralph Alloco (Rochester, NY/McQuaid) and Nate Harris (Pittsford, NY/McQuaid) will trade the Black and Gold of Monroe Community College for the Red and Blue of the University of Dayton when they leave East Henrietta Road and head west for I-75.
